Foreword by Billy Graham, this is "The Classic Story of the Jesus Movement - Retold for a New Generation." Dropped out, turned on, then fired up for God...the story of Mike MacIntosh is full of hope for every generation.

MICHAEL MACINTOSH had seen and done it all, from UFO-watching in a drug induced haze, to incarceration in the mental ward of the Orange County Medical Center. He was a free spirit, a product of the 60s. He couldn't have been more miserable. By 1970, his desire to follow the lifestyle of the Beatles had led him nowhere, and on his twenty-sixth birthday, MacIntosh found his true Savior, Jesus Christ. Two years later he was ordained, his marriage was restored and, in 1974, he started teaching a Bible study in San Diego at the insistence of friends. Twelve people were in the original group. Today over one hundred churches, Horizon Christian Academy and Horizon University have started from the original group, and tens of thousands are being reached directly through Mike's ministries.

This is the newly updated, expanded edition of the story as originally told to Sherwood Wirt, founding editor of Billy Graham's Decision Magazine.
